Unfortunately, the best beaches in Nasugbu and Calatagan areas are private beaches. In the case of Playa Calatagan, there will be a public beach area and a private pool/ clubhouse area for lot owners. There is no membership fee in this residential resort (which is a new concept) but you need to be a lot owner to use the facilities. Some time in the future, there will be commercial establishments for the public crowd and I can’t wait to share this with you.

For now, the pool area is for private lot owner’s use and their dependents. Just to give you a flavor of how much it would cost to enjoy a day trip in Playa Calatagan:

Pool Usage Fee:
Lot Owner & Dependents (P100/ Adult, P50/ Child).
Guests (P200/adult, P100/ child)

Towel & Shower Fee Rental (P70)
Whole Body Massage (P350/ 1hour)

Cabana Usage Fee:

Week days:
Pool Cabanas (Small | Medium | Large) — We love the pool cabanas, it is like having your private jacuzzi in the cabana.
9am-1:00pm (P200 | P300 | P400)
1:00pm-6:00pm (P200 | P300 | P400)
9am – 6:00pm (P400 | P600 | P800)

Garden Cabanas (Medium) — We love the 2nd floor garden cabanas because of the privacy it offers.
9am-1:00pm (P300 )
1:00pm-6:00pm (P300)
9am – 6:00pm (P600)

Weekends/ Holidays:
Pool Cabanas (Small | Medium | Large)
9am-1:00pm (P300 | P500 | P700)
1:00pm-6:00pm (P300 | P500 | P700)
9am – 6:00pm (P600 | P1,000 | P1,400)

Garden Cabanas (Medium)
9am-1:00pm (P500 )
1:00pm-6:00pm (P500)
9am – 6:00pm (P1000)


Golden Calatagan Sunset at Playa Calatagan

Beach Club Complex is open from:
9am-6pm on Tuesday to Friday
9am-7pm on Saturday to Sunday.

Playa Calatagan Menu

The food is decent based on Manila standards but this is the best resto in the Calatagan area. Don’t try the halo-halo though…


Chicken Yakitori (P140+). Chicken Skewers served with Teriyaki Sauce


Chicken BBQ (P180+) Marinated chicken quarters with our special native sweet barbeque sauce. Skewed then grilled into desired doneness.


Beef Steak Pinoy (P160+). Filipino Style fillets served with caramelized onions.


Grilled Suchi Fillets (P170+). Grilled Fillet of Suchi fish drizzled with Lemon cream sauce served with Mango Salsa.
